Description of task

Within the delegated authority and under the supervision of the Programme Policy Officer or his/her designated mandated representative(s), the UNV Senior Programme Associate will:

  • Provide efficient coordination of WFP in-kind food distributions to ensure that the various activities are performed within the established targets following WFP’s policies and procedures;
  • Prepare a variety of elaborated reports and substantial data analysis on WFP in-kind operation (e.g. programme status, performance) and make recommendations to supervisors, ensuring deliverables adhere to corporate standards and quality control;
  • Ensure accurate, timely recording of data and consistency of information and narrative inputs presented to stakeholder;
  • Coordinate and liaise with internal counterparts in particular the Partnerships, Supply Chain, IT, VAM, M&E and Finance Units, to enable effective collaboration, implementation and monitoring of ongoing project activities;
  • Foster relationships and support partnership-building with local partners, agencies, NGOs and government institutions to ensure efficient delivery of food assistance. Act as an escalation point for complex query resolution on all matters within the area of responsibility;
  • Follow standard emergency preparedness practices to ensure WFP is able to quickly respond and deploy needed resources to affected areas at the onset of the crisis;
  • Perform other duties as needed.
